Change your activities and allow yourself to get distracted from time to time

Of course, there are not so many people who really enjoy the subject of their studies to such an extent that they can literally spend hours working on it without a stop. Yet, even if you are one of such people, it is still highly recommended for you to change your tasks or activity from time to time, otherwise you are risking to lose your productivity. In fact, the people who are less interested in their work can easily notice the moment when their activity stops being productive which is not necessarily true for the people who are absorbed by their studies.

It does not matter how much you actually enjoy the process as the productivity of the human’s brain still has some limits. There are many approaches to making breaks in your studies and you have certainly heard of some of them. For example, one of the most popular techniques is undeniably the Pomodoro method which allows people to work or study for twenty five minutes and then make a five-minute break. Still, everyone is different and you might prefer longer periods of work. In such a case, you can try a method which is based on an hour and a half period of work and a thirty-minute break.

It will be particularly efficient if you change your activity during a break and specifically, to a physical activity. In such a way, you will have a chance to literally boost your productivity since it has already been proved that sports is one of the major factors increasing the cognitive function of brain.

Pick the most effective methods for learning

It is absolutely vital for your education to choose the best possible forms of learning. No matter what is your personal attitude to particular ways of learning, there were many experiments conducted on the efficiency of studies which showed that there the fact whether an individual loves a particular form of learning or not actually does not change its effectiveness.

For example, reading is more effective for memorising material than listening to audio materials regardless of whether you prefer the first one or the second one. Needless to say, you should take it into consideration especially while preparing for especially serious examinations.

At the same time, there is nothing strange in the fact people will just be more motivated to study when they enjoy the form of learning available to them. Undeniably, if a person hates reading and is crazy about watching films, he or she will be a way more willing to study a foreign language by watching films with subtitles than by reading books no matter how effective the latter option is. At some point, it is possible to compensate such lack of effectiveness by increased motivation to study which is also crucial for a learning process.

Pick the learning materials according to your current level of knowledge

This recommendation is more applicable to the people who are looking for ways to study on their own and are searching for various books and online-courses earmarked for self-education.

It is obvious that you will not be excited if the course you pick is too difficult and you will also be rather demotivated if you already know the material of the course pretty well. The letter one will work only in the case if you have to complete a particular course for the sake of getting a certificate. Otherwise, the learning process can change into a real torture especially if you are learning at home alone rather than attending the course physically.

For this reason, you should be very picky while choosing such learning programmes for self-education and dig more for the information regarding the level of preparation required by the course.
